Asus producing Android cellphone in 2009
Mobile | by C.K. Sample III | Wed Oct 29, 2008 9:48AM | 0 comments
According to DigiTimes, Asus will offer a Google Android based cellphone in the first half of 2009. Not much is known about the new cellphone as of now, other than it will most likely go on sale in Taiwan before being offered elsewhere.
